Durability: Recognizing the Sturdiness and Life-span of Oral Implants and Dentures



Think about the long life and life expectancy of dental implants and dentures when choosing which alternative is right for you. Both oral implants and dentures have their own durability and life expectancy, and it's important to understand these elements before deciding.

Here are four bottom lines to think about:

1. Implants: Oral implants are created to be a permanent solution for missing out on teeth. With correct treatment and upkeep, they can last a life time. This is due to the fact that implants are surgically positioned in the jawbone, supplying a stable structure for synthetic teeth.

2. Dentures: Dentures, on the other hand, are detachable devices that change missing out on teeth. While dentista cerca de mi can be an affordable choice, they normally have a much shorter life-span compared to implants. Dentures may need to be replaced every 5-7 years as a result of deterioration.

3. Maintenance: Oral implants require normal brushing, flossing, and dental check-ups, just like natural teeth. Dentures require daily cleaning and soaking to prevent germs accumulation.

4. Bone Health and wellness: Dental implants promote the jawbone, avoiding bone loss and preserving facial structure. Dentures, nonetheless, don't give the exact same level of excitement, which can bring about bone loss with time.

Oral Wellness Benefits: Analyzing the Influence of Oral Implants and Dentures on General Oral Health And Wellness



Keeping appropriate oral hygiene is critical in analyzing the effect of oral implants and dentures on your total dental health and wellness.



Oral implants provide substantial dental wellness advantages as they work like natural teeth, promoting the jawbone and avoiding bone loss. This aids in preserving the structure and stability of your jaw, which subsequently sustains your face features.

With dental implants, you can enjoy a much more all-natural attacking and eating experience, enabling you to eat a bigger variety of foods comfortably. Furthermore, dental implants don't require any kind of unique cleansing methods; you can simply comb and floss them like your natural teeth.

On the other hand, dentures require unique care and cleaning, as they require to be eliminated and cleaned independently. Dentures can additionally trigger gum irritation and pain if not appropriately fitted.
